      Oxford Rail makes a Bedford with a "Queen Mary" trailer that was Designed to carry a Hurricane or Spitfire with the wings removed, Airfix used to make a kit of it, both were 1/76 th or OO scale. Could give ideas for the mounting rig for the aircraft.

      The only thing to be careful with is the slight mismatch in scale between Airfix aircraft (1/72) and Hornby (1/76). Unfortunately it's just enough to cause problems with bridges, overhangs, etc. It is possible find OO scale aircraft but they are rare.

      I see this question was two years ago but when I had a Hornby as a kid in the 70's they did a sprung 'ramp' that sat between the tracks. You'd put it just past the points on the siding and pushing a wagon over it and stopping would uncouple the thing as they weren't under tension. The wagon would roll off to the buffer stop. When under tension the ramp didn't interfere with the couplings, would just depress. I also had a Triang/Hornby spade-like tool in black vinyl that you'd slip under the couplings to lift them.
